The engrossing thriller Bleed For Me by Michael Robotham follows a psychologist’s attempts to unravel the mystery surrounding his daughter’s best friend who has been charged with murder.
When Sienna Hegarty turns up at his family home one night, covered in blood and frozen in shock, psychologist Joe O'Loughlin finds himself drawn deep into her world, trying to unearth the dark secrets her mind has buried. The police find a major piece of the puzzle at Sienna's house: her father, a retired cop, is face-down in a pool of his own blood, his throat slashed and his skull caved in. The blood covering Sienna was his.
